The Opportunity:
CACI is seeking a Full Stack Web Developer to join our dynamic technology team. As a Full Stack Developer. You will serve as a key member of our development team, building responsive, scalable, and high-performance applications and software that solves complex national security challenges.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to design, develop, and maintain both frontend and backend components of our applications and software.


You will be responsible for the full development lifecycle from conceptualization to deployment. This includes designing system architecture, implementing frontend and backend components, integrating with databases, and ensuring the performance, reliability, and security of our applications. You'll work in an agile environment with opportunities to learn new technologies and contribute to innovative solutions.

Responsibilities:
• Design and develop modern web applications using React.js for frontend and Flask/Express.js for backend services
• Build and maintain RESTful APIs that power our applications and integrate with various data sources
• Implement responsive user interfaces using HTML5, CSS3, and modern JavaScript frameworks
• Work with PostgreSQL databases to design schemas, optimize queries, and ensure data integrity
• Collaborate with UX/UI designers to translate wireframes and mockups into functional code
• Participate in code reviews and implement best practices for version control using Git
• Debug issues across the entire stack and propose solutions to improve application performance
• Contribute to technical documentation to support knowledge sharing and maintenance

Qualifications:
Required:
• B.S. in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Computer Engineering or related field
• 5+ years of professional experience in web development
• Strong proficiency with React.js and modern JavaScript/TypeScript development
• Experience building backend APIs with Flask (Python) and Express.js (Node.js)
• Proficient in Python, HTML5, CSS3, TypeScript, and JavaScript
• Experience with PostgreSQL and writing efficient SQL queries
• Strong understanding of RESTful API design principles
• Experience with version control systems (Git) and collaborative development workflows
• Problem-solving mindset with attention to detail and code quality
• Strong communication skills and ability to work effectively in a team
environment

*Must have an active TS/SCI Clearance

Desired:
• Experience with GitLab CI/CD pipelines and DevOps workflows
• Knowledge of Docker containerization and deployment strategies
• Familiarity with WebSockets for real-time communication
• Knowledge of the Tailwind CSS framework for building responsive interfaces
• Experience with ORM libraries (SQLAlchemy, Prisma, Drizzle, etc.)
• Experience with Tanstack Tools (Router, Query, Forms)
• Experience with Redis for caching and session management
• Understanding of web security best practices
• Experience with automated testing frameworks for both frontend and backend
• Knowledge of c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P)
